Daisy is a Mule. A Mule is a cross between a "Jack-ass" stud and a Quarter horse mare. Daisy's father was a "Mammoth Jack" So, she is a BIG Mule. She stands 16 hands at the shoulder.
This picture was taken the first day Steve took Daisy to the round corral. She's still a little unsure about the 'man-gate' she has to go through to get back into the horse pasture. (Man-gate means that it's big enough for a man, not a big mule!!) Horses and Mules and naturally claustrophobic. So, the fact that Steve is able to get her through this gate is pretty amazing. Even more so, on the first day of training.
